Niclas Fullkrug January transfer exit update shared at West Ham United

West Ham currently have no plans to get rid of Niclas Fullkrug ahead of the January transfer window, according to Suddeutsche Zeitung.

The German outlet reported [12 November] that the Hammers are backing their new striker signing despite only making four appearances in all competitions since arriving on a £27million last summer [BBC Sport].

Fullkrug has been sidelined since September, having sustained an Achilles tendon injury during the September international break, with frustrations growing among the fanbase since.

West Ham United to stick or twist with Niclas Fullkrug?

The 31-year-old was certainly an interesting choice from Tim Steidten during the summer transfer window, but it was clear that a new striker was needed at the London Stadium.

The Hammers have been subjected to some awful striker transfers over the years, with fans cringing at some of the names who have walked through the doors in East London.

While it seems far too early to judge Fullkrug, given his recent seasons in the Bundesliga before moving to the Premier League, fans have every right to be frustrated with the current situation.

Injuries are just part of the game but the constant negative updates on the forward have only added frustration to Julen Lopetegui’s reign, with his injury timeline only extending.

The main frustration comes from the fact that the Hammers were close to signing Aston Villa star Jhon Duran, who has hit the ground running this season at Villa Park. Fans feel like they’ve missed out.

Instead, the Hammers have Michail Antonio and Danny Ings at their disposal, two strikers who have scored a total of two goals in all competitions so far this season.

Many are already calling for a brand-new striker to be bought ahead of the January transfer window, with PSG’s Randal Kolo Muani the latest transfer link [TBR Football], but it looks as though Fullkrug has all faith for now.
